Leveraging Oil and Gas Shore Tank Lease Agreements: A Practical Guide

Securing lucrative with favorable oil and gas shore tank lease agreements requires a strategic strategy. Leaseholders should meticulously analyze key factors such as lease length, rental terms, and compliance stipulations. A well-negotiated lease can enhance your revenue while mitigating potential liabilities.

  • Negotiate clear conditions for tank placement, maintenance, and removal.
  • Specify provisions for liability coverage to protect your interests.
  • Scrutinize environmental standards and ensure compliance throughout the lease term.

Engage experienced legal and economic professionals to assist you through the nuances of shore tank lease agreements.

Charting South Africa's Strict Oil Storage Regulations

South Africa implements comprehensive regulations dictating the storage and handling of oil. Businesses involved in the distribution or manipulation of oil must conform to these regulations. Failure to do so can result in harsh consequences, including monetary action. To confirm compliance, companies should seek with industry experts and diligently review the relevant codes. Moreover, it is vital to implement robust safety procedures to reduce the risk of incidents.

  • Essential aspects of South African oil storage regulations include: permitting, licensing, inspection, safety training, and emergency response planning.

Mastering Oil Shore Tank Logistics: Effective Operations & Cost Savings

Successfully navigating the complexities of oil shore tank logistics requires a strategic blend of meticulous planning and operational excellence. By implementing robust systems for tank management, inventory control, and transportation coordination, companies can achieve significant cost savings. A key aspect of efficient shore tank logistics involves leveraging automation to streamline operations. This incorporates real-time monitoring of tank levels, automated dispatching for transportation, and detailed reporting to identify areas for improvement. Furthermore, prioritizing proactive maintenance programs can prevent costly downtime and ensure the longevity of your tank assets.
